如何使用Python来处理数据集
Python 是一种非常强大的编程语言,可以帮助我们处理大量的数据集。下面就介绍一下使用 Python 处理数据集的一些方法。
1. 导入数据集
首先,我们需要将数据集导入 Python 环境中。Python 提供了多种读取数据集的方式,如 pandas 库中的 read_csv() 函数可以读取 csv 格式的文件,read_excel() 函数可以读取 Excel 格式的文件等等。导入数据集后,我们可以使用 pandas 库中的 DataFrame 来创建一个包含数据的表格。
2. 数据预处理
一般来说,数据集中存在着缺失值、异常值、重复值等问题,这些问题可能会对我们的数据分析和建模造成影响。因此,数据预处理是非常重要的一步。
对于缺失值,我们可以使用 DataFrame 中的 dropna() 函数来删除缺失值所在的行或者列,使用 fillna() 函数来填充缺失值。对于异常值,我们可以使用统计学方法,如均值、中位数等来进行处理。对于重复值,我们可以使用 drop_duplicates() 函数来删除所有重复的行。
3. 数据分析
在数据预处理之后,我们就可以开始进行数据分析了。常见的数据分析方法包括统计分析、可视化分析、机器学习等。
统计分析可以帮助我们了解数据集中不同特征之间的关系、变量间的相关性等。例如,使用 pandas 库中的 describe() 函数可以得到数据集的主要统计量,使用 corr() 函数可以计算数据集中变量之间的相关性。
可视化分析可以帮助我们更加直观地理解数据集。例如,使用 matplotlib 库中的 scatter() 函数可以绘制散点图来展示数据集中不同变量之间的关系,使用 bar() 函数可以绘制柱状图来展示不同类别之间的比较。
机器学习是一种更加深入的数据分析方法,它通过构建各种模型,来预测未来的趋势,或者对数据集进行分类、聚类等操作。常见的机器学习算法包括线性回归、逻辑回归、决策树、神经网络等。
4. 数据导出
最后,我们还需要将分析结果输出到文件中,以便于后续的使用和分享。Python 提供了多种文件格式,如 csv、Excel、JSON、XML 等等,我们可以使用 DataFrame 中的 to_csv()、to_excel() 函数来将分析结果导出到相应的文件中。
综上所述,Python 是一种非常强大的数据分析工具,提供了丰富的库和函数来处理大量的数据集。当我们掌握了 Python 的基本语法和一些常用的库之后,便可以进行各种复杂的数据处理和分析操作。
